A kind of nucleating agent of polyethylene terephthalate and preparation method thereof
A technology of polyethylene terephthalate and nucleating agent, which is applied in the field of nucleating agent and preparation of polyethylene terephthalate, and can solve the problem of difficulty in finding compatibilizer, difficulty in industrialization, and operation process Complexity and other issues, to achieve the effect of accelerating the crystallization rate, increasing the melting crystallization temperature, and simple preparation process

Embodiment 1
[0025] (1) Synthesis of polystyrene-b-poly(styrene-alt-maleic anhydride) diblock copolymer
[0026] Mix 106g of styrene, 2.45g of maleic anhydride, 0.0684g of cumyl dithiobenzoate (CDB) and 0.0208g of azobisethylbutyronitrile (AIBN) into the reaction flask, and react in a nitrogen atmosphere at 60°C 12 hours. The product was filtered through a large amount of methanol precipitation, and purified twice by THF dissolution-methanol precipitation. Dry in a vacuum oven at 60°C for 24 hours to obtain a polystyrene-b-poly(styrene-alt-maleic anhydride) diblock copolymer.
[0027] (2) Preparation of polystyrene-b-poly(styrene-alt-maleic anhydride) diblock ionomer
[0028] Dissolve the dried polystyrene-b-poly(styrene-alt-maleic anhydride) diblock copolymer in 1,4-dioxane solution, add sodium hydroxide to the solution in methanol saturated Solution, when its pH value is about 7 as measured by pH test paper, stop dropping methanol solution. Embodiment 2
[0030] (1) Synthesis of polystyrene-b-poly(styrene-alt-maleic anhydride) diblock copolymer
[0031]Mix 52g of styrene, 0.273g of CDB and 0.04145g of AIBN into the reaction flask, and react at 60°C for 24h in a nitrogen atmosphere to synthesize a macromolecular PS-RAFT reagent with a relative molecular weight of 12670. The purification of the product is the same as in Example 1. Dry in a vacuum oven at 60° C. for 24 hours to obtain a dry PS-RAFT reagent.
[0032] Mix 7.38g of styrene, 6.9g of maleic anhydride, 3g of PS-RAFT reagent, 0.019g of AIBN and 50ml of cyclohexanone solvent into the reaction flask, react at 60°C for 35 minutes in a nitrogen atmosphere, and synthesize by chain extension The relative molecular weight of the poly(styrene-alt-maleic anhydride) block is 7341. Example 1 of crude product purification method, drying in a vacuum oven at 60°C for 24 hours to obtain polystyrene-b-poly(styrene-alt-maleic anhydride) diblock copolymer.

Embodiment 3
[0036] (1) Synthesis of polystyrene-b-poly(styrene-alt-maleic anhydride) diblock copolymer
[0037] Mix 10.6g of styrene, 9.8g of maleic anhydride, 0.0546g of CDB and 0.0164g of AIBN with 50ml of solvent and add them to the reaction flask, and react at 60°C for about 2 hours under the protection of nitrogen to obtain a macromolecular SMA-RAFT reagent , and its relative molecular weight is about 16000. After the product is purified, it is dried in a vacuum oven at 60°C for 24 hours to obtain a dry macromolecular SMA-RAFT reagent.
[0038] Mix 50g of styrene, 3g of SMA-RAFT reagent and 0.0154g of AIBN into the reaction flask, and react at 60°C for 8 hours in a nitrogen atmosphere, polystyrene-b-poly(styrene-alt-maleic anhydride) diblock copolymers. The product purification method was the same as that of Example 1, and it was dried in a vacuum oven at 60°C for 24 hours to obtain polystyrene-b-poly(styrene-alt-maleic anhydride) diblock copolymer.
